Nail Care In The Heat: Say Goodbye to Yellowing, Peeling & Brittleness – The Natural Way! 💅☀️

Hot weather doesn’t just affect your skin and hair — your nails also take a hit! From yellowing and dryness to brittleness and peeling, summer heat can weaken nails and strip away their natural shine. But don’t worry — nature has the cure. Let’s dive into natural tips to keep your nails healthy, shiny, and strong all summer long.

🌞 Why Summer Harms Your Nails

High heat, humidity, chlorine from pools, UV exposure, and even dehydration can:

  • Strip your nails of moisture

  • Weaken the nail bed

  • Cause yellowing or discoloration

  • Lead to peeling, splitting, or breakage

💚 Natural Tips to Keep Nails Strong & Healthy


Hydration is Everything

Just like skin, nails need moisture!

  • Drink plenty of water (8–10 glasses/day)

  • Apply natural oils like coconut oil, olive oil, or almond oil to nails and cuticles every night.

  • Try soaking nails in warm olive oil once a week — it deeply nourishes brittle nails.

2. Fight Yellowing with Lemon

Lemon juice acts as a natural bleach.

  • Rub fresh lemon slices on nails or soak nails in lemon juice for 5–10 mins.

  • Rinse with warm water and moisturize.

  • Repeat twice a week for visible brightening!

⚠️ Don’t do this on cracked or cut skin – it may sting!

3. Say Yes to Biotin-Rich Foods

Biotin strengthens keratin (your nail protein).
Include:

  • Almonds, eggs, walnuts

  • Sweet potatoes

  • Bananas

  • Whole grains

  • Spinach

You can also try biotin supplements (consult a doctor first).

4. Go Bare Sometimes

Too much nail polish and acetone-based removers can damage nails.

  • Take nail polish breaks weekly.

  • Use acetone-free removers with natural ingredients.

  • Try herbal nail tints if you love color but want gentler options.

5. Cool Down Chlorine Damage

After swimming:

  • Rinse hands and nails with fresh water immediately.

  • Moisturize with coconut oil or a light shea butter cream.

6. Avoid Nail Biting & Picking

Heat can cause dryness and temptation to bite or peel nails.

  • Apply bitter neem oil as a natural deterrent.

  • Keep nails neatly trimmed to avoid breakage and temptation.

7. Use a Natural Nail Soak

Soothing soak recipe:

  • 1 tbsp olive oil

  • Juice of half a lemon

  • 2 drops of lavender oil (optional)

Mix and soak nails for 10–15 minutes once a week for glossy, stronger nails.

8. Don’t Forget Your Diet

Your nails reflect your internal health. Ensure your diet includes:

  • Protein

  • Iron

  • Zinc

  • Omega-3s

  • Vitamin E

Tip: Moringa, drumsticks, curry leaves, and sesame seeds are natural nail boosters!
